However, human creativity is unique in that it has transformed our planet. Given that the anatomy of the human brain is not so different from that of the great apes, what enables us to be so creative? Recent collaborations at the frontier of anthropology, archaeology, psychology, and cognitive science are culminating in speculative but increasingly sophisticated efforts to answer to this question.
